In-Person Absentee Voting Dates and Times:

In-person absentee voting hours are generally Monday - Thursday, 8 a.m. to 4:30 p.m., and Friday, 8 a.m. to noon, the two weeks preceding an election.  On the Friday before the election, the hours are typically 8 a.m. to 5 p.m.
